A new Uniqlo in Pentagon City is hosting its grand opening this week, offering free treats, merch and manga-style portraits to select customers.

The Japanese fast-fashion brand will open for business at 10 a.m. tomorrow (Friday) following a taiko drum performance by the Mark H Taiko Connection. This will kick off an opening weekend of limited-time offers and giveaways at the Fashion Centre at Pentagon City.

Arlington Beer Garden will soon open for business.

Sunday will mark the grand opening at 3217 10th Street N. in Clarendon, starting a new chapter for the establishment formerly known as The Lot.

Free dog washes are coming to the grand opening of a new pet supply store and “grooming salon” in North Arlington.

Wag N’ Wash, now open at the former site of Loyal Companion pet store at 2501 N. Harrison Street, in the Lee-Harrison Shopping Center, offers dog owners a chance to pamper their pups with self-service dog wash stations, professional grooming services and an array of pet products.

After a multi-week soft opening, 2910 Kitchen & Bar is set to hold its official grand opening this weekend.

Located at 2910 Columbia Pike, the restaurant serving American cuisine will officially open on Friday, May 10 and host a Mother’s Day brunch and dinner on Saturday and Sunday. Additionally, husband-and-wife owners Raheel “Ray” Khan and Griselda Giselle Fernandez plan to hold a ribbon-cutting ceremony on Sunday at 5 p.m., according to a press release.

The plaza in front of George Mason University’s Virginia Square campus has a refreshed look and a fresh set of events for spring.

Mason Square Plaza was redesigned to “better support a range of activities and increase engagement.” The open space has an assortment of new amenities including an art cart, ping pong tables, mini golf, chess, and a few other activities.

(Updated 3/14) A BurgerFi is opening in Rosslyn.

The Florida-based burger chain plans to hold a grand opening later this month, with free drinks and fries deals, for its new location at 1735 N. Lynn Street. It will be the franchise’s first foray into Arlington.

The Pentagon City mall is adding a dash of South American flavor to its dining options.

Maizal, situated on the mall’s exterior along S. Hayes Street adjacent to Macy’s, is gearing up to open next week, according to a company spokesperson.

(Updated at 5:32 p.m.) Greenheart Juice Shop is slated to hold a grand opening for its newest location in Ballston on Saturday.

The celebration at 4121 Wilson Blvd will include wellness shots, and attendees can enter a raffle for a chance to win gift cards or class packs to local gyms.

Three years after opening its doors in Ballston in the middle of a global pandemic, VIDA Fitness is holding a grand opening this Saturday.

“It sounds odd, off the cuff, close to three years after the grand opening to do a party, but this was the first time in the timeline to do it,” VIDA Fitness Director of Operations Aaron Moore tells ARLnow.

A church featuring a 500-person capacity auditorium is about to open at Ballston Quarter mall.

Grace Community Church, which had previously been holding services at Arlington’s Thomas Jefferson Middle School, is planning a grand opening at Ballston Quarter this coming Sunday, March 19.
